My youngest DS had a field trip in Glacier National Park on Tuesday. I went along as a helper. The science classes go to GNP a couple of times a year and see how they reseed native plants in the Fall and then participate in reforesting them in the Spring.
One of the 'stations' was seed collecting and preparation. They covered removing seeds from cones of trees and I asked questions about propagating some of the Blue Spruce trees on our property. I was given some advice and referred to a site online since BS does not grow in GNP, they were not familiar with some of the needs of a BS seed.
I think it seems like a very helpful site so I am going to post it here: Native Plants Database
